Ticket #— Floor 9 Opening Prep, Brindlemoor House

Hi facilities folks, Floor 9 opens to staff next Monday and we need a few things squared away before then. Lift access is live, but the two side doors by the kitchenette are still on the old lock config — please reprogram them before Friday. Also, signage for the quiet rooms hasn't arrived, so pop up the temporary printed ones for now. Until the badge readers sync, the interim door code for Floor 9 is below.

door code, bajop-bajog: bdg-DSWAC-43621

Quarterly Planning Note — For the Incoming Director

Headcount plan, next year: net +12. Engineering +8, support +3, ops +1. Freeze on backfills in the Quillbrook office until Q2. Attrition assumed at 9%. Budget already cleared by finance. Contractor conversions capped at four. One caveat shapes all of this — see the confidential note below.

management briefing: Ralokix Partners plans to lower the Istath list price by 38 percent in October.

**Vendor note: Inkmill markdown pipeline**

Rendering for Parchway docs is outsourced to Inkmill under an annual contract, renewing each March. They handle sanitization and PDF export; we own the upload queue. SLA: 4-hour response on rendering failures. Escalate only after two failed retries. Their support desk is reachable at the address below.

billing contact of hahaf-baguf = zorael.tammir.jorius@sivrelhq.internal

**Q: What does the facilities desk need for a Corvane cage visit?** Visits to the Corvane cage at the Dathlow data centre require an approved ticket and an escort from the infrastructure rota. Confirm the visitor's name against the rota before releasing anything. Once the escort signs the log, issue the cage-door code shown below.

turnstile pass: bdg-CY-5